Achieving Inner Peace: A Guide to Cultivating Mental Wellness

Inner peace is not a goal but rather a continuous path. It requires deliberate effort and development over time. Cultivate these practices to foster a sense of calmness, clarity, and harmony:

  • Mindfulness exercises can guide you to concentrate on the current moment.
  • Regular exercise releases endorphins, which boost your mood and reduce stress.
  • Engage with loved ones and build strong social connections.
  • Cherish self-care activities that bring you happiness.
  • Explore professional help if you are struggling to cope your psychological health.

Remember, the path to inner peace is unique to each person. Be kind with yourself and acknowledge your progress.
